#!/usr/bin/python
__author__ = "Michael Rest"
__date__ = "2016/09/01"
__email__ = "mr@mir.systems"
__version__ = "$Revision: 1.1 $"[11:-2]
from telegram import TELEGRAM, TEL_PD07
from telegram import tsdecode
from states import *
def fromstring (data):
"""
Decode the binary representation of a PD_tel from the given
parameter and note the data in the instance of the object.
Parameters:
data: The binary form of the TELEGRAM
"""
tel = TEL_PD07 ()
try:
tel.attrib['nr'] = (data [0] << 8) + data [1]
except:
print ("Debug-Nr", data[0], data[1])
tel.attrib['src'] = data [2:4].decode ()
tel.attrib['dst'] = data [4:6].decode ()
tel.attrib['type'] = data [6:10].decode ()
tel.attrib['dmc'] = (data [10:38]).decode ().rstrip (' \x00')
tel.attrib['startts'] = tsdecode (data [38:52].decode ())
tel.attrib['endts'] = tsdecode (data [52:66].decode ())
#66-70 Varianten daten
tel.attrib['bauteilstatus'] = bauteilstatus.get (chr (data [70]), '') #0 - unbearbeitet; 1 - iO; 2 - niO
tel.attrib['clipstatus01'] = bearbeitungsstatus.get (chr (data [71]), '') #0 - unbearbeitet; 1 - iO; 2 - niO
tel.attrib['clipstatus02'] = bearbeitungsstatus.get (chr (data [72]), '') #0 - unbearbeitet; 1 - iO; 2 - niO
tel.attrib['clipstatus03'] = bearbeitungsstatus.get (chr (data [73]), '') #0 - unbearbeitet; 1 - iO; 2 - niO
tel.attrib['clipstatus04'] = bearbeitungsstatus.get (chr (data [74]), '') #0 - unbearbeitet; 1 - iO; 2 - niO
tel.attrib['clipstatus05'] = bearbeitungsstatus.get (chr (data [75]), '') #0 - unbearbeitet; 1 - iO; 2 - niO
tel.attrib['clipstatus06'] = bearbeitungsstatus.get (chr (data [76]), '') #0 - unbearbeitet; 1 - iO; 2 - niO
tel.attrib['clipstatus07'] = bearbeitungsstatus.get (chr (data [77]), '') #0 - unbearbeitet; 1 - iO; 2 - niO
tel.attrib['clipstatus08'] = bearbeitungsstatus.get (chr (data [78]), '') #0 - unbearbeitet; 1 - iO; 2 - niO
tel.attrib['clipstatus09'] = bearbeitungsstatus.get (chr (data [79]), '') #0 - unbearbeitet; 1 - iO; 2 - niO
tel.attrib['clipstatus10'] = bearbeitungsstatus.get (chr (data [80]), '') #0 - unbearbeitet; 1 - iO; 2 - niO
tel.attrib['clipstatus11'] = bearbeitungsstatus.get (chr (data [81]), '') #0 - unbearbeitet; 1 - iO; 2 - niO
tel.attrib['clipstatus12'] = bearbeitungsstatus.get (chr (data [82]), '') #0 - unbearbeitet; 1 - iO; 2 - niO
tel.attrib['clipstatus13'] = bearbeitungsstatus.get (chr (data [83]), '') #0 - unbearbeitet; 1 - iO; 2 - niO
tel.attrib['clipstatus14'] = bearbeitungsstatus.get (chr (data [84]), '') #0 - unbearbeitet; 1 - iO; 2 - niO
tel.attrib['clipstatus15'] = bearbeitungsstatus.get (chr (data [85]), '') #0 - unbearbeitet; 1 - iO; 2 - niO
tel.attrib['clipstatus16'] = bearbeitungsstatus.get (chr (data [86]), '') #0 - unbearbeitet; 1 - iO; 2 - niO
tel.attrib['clipstatus17'] = bearbeitungsstatus.get (chr (data [87]), '') #0 - unbearbeitet; 1 - iO; 2 - niO
tel.attrib['clipstatus18'] = bearbeitungsstatus.get (chr (data [88]), '') #0 - unbearbeitet; 1 - iO; 2 - niO
try:
tel.attrib['aufnahme'] = (data [90] << 8) + data [91]
except:
print ("Debug-aufnahme", data[90], data[91])
tel.attrib['ladungstraeger'] = data [92:94].decode ()
return tel
